A ‘CARELESSLY’ discarded cigarette is believed to have set fire to two industrial waste bins in Warrington.
Firefighters were called to Winwick Street at 5.20am this morning, Saturday.
A spokesman for Cheshire Fire and Rescue Service said: “A carelessly discarded cigarette is believed to be the cause of a fire involving two industrial waste bins in a compound.
“Firefighters used a hose reel jet to put the fire out.
“There was no damage to any nearby buildings.”
One fire engine from Warrington dealt with the incident.
Firefighters also tackled a fire in the open on Bewsey Farm Close shortly before 9pm last night.
A water backpack was used to put out the fire.
